Output e9f6662c367f8dc6967859cc0339361c05df9bdbcab47f526c5650d4d1cd5216:0

value
251489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cc1b40fc42221d784fa39acd1c7824c85341b2 OP_EQUAL
address
34mijSTD8H2onWqEPDP5NfpDbBmwGoeoeL
transaction
e9f6662c367f8dc6967859cc0339361c05df9bdbcab47f526c5650d4d1cd5216
confirmations
148835
spent
true